Liu Jiafu, 1970 was born in Jinan, Shandong Province. He is now a member of China Calligraphers Association, a director of China Painting and Calligraphy Research Institute, vice president of Tianying Painting and Calligraphy Institute of World Chinese Merchants United Painting and Calligraphy Institute, and honorary president of Shandong Xizhi Painting and Calligraphy Institute. Graduated from Qinghai University, a first-class calligrapher.

Liu Jiafu was born in a calligraphy family since childhood. He was inspired by his grandfather to study calligraphy. Later, he joined Wu Zhongqi and Qigong, which was handed down from his own family. He has been in the pool for more than 40 years, forming his own style, and his works are solemn and generous. His works have been auctioned in Hongkong and many places at home and abroad, and have been appraised by China Calligraphy and Painting Appraisal Committee as 6000-8000 yuan square feet.

His works have participated in many national, world Chinese and provincial painting and calligraphy exhibitions and won many awards.
